The Bachelor of Nursing Science program at Queen’s University is a four-year, full-time program. The program offers hands-on practical experience in a variety of responsive clinical settings, producing experienced, confident nurses. Graduates of this program receive a Bachelor of Nursing degree, and after passing their professional certification exam, are designated as Registered Nurses.

The school’s philosophy is that exemplary nursing practice is built upon the foundational blocks of the sciences and arts.

This four-year program offers practice nursing skills taught each year in the School of Nursing Simulation Lab and GSK Clinical Education Centre. Over years two, three and four students will complete clinical practice in children’s, maternity, mental health, hospitalized patients, and community.  Settings include hospitals, public health, clinics and community agencies (such as schools, flu clinics, Alzheimer agencies).
